Ordaz is a 22-year-old attacking midfielder at Los Angeles FC, rated 45.8 overall by Field Insider's model, ranking 24th of 513 on scout potential in the Major League Soccer and 1346th of 2874 U-23 players tracked. An emerging talent, he has been a rotation option this season (47.4% of available minutes). He brings 0.56 goal contributions per 90 (0.37 goals, 0.19 assists). Below: strengths, watch-points, market-value outlook and the latest transfer news on Ordaz.

Judged on this season alone, Ordaz graded 26 — a workmanlike campaign that ranks 25th of 50 of the 50 attacking midfielders in the Major League Soccer, on 6 goals and 3 assists in 27 appearances (0.559 involvements per 90).

Year-on-year, that's a clear step up on last season (Season 5 → 26). Across the 3 seasons we hold, it's his best return yet.

On long-term talent our Rating reads 46, top 12% of the 50 attacking midfielders in the Major League Soccer. At 22 Ordaz is still climbing toward his ceiling, and a market index of 8.1 reflects that trajectory.

Read the appearance count in context: Ordaz missed 3 games through injury (international duty) out of roughly 37 this season. The 27 he did play is a solid return on the time he was fit, and his ratings are weighted toward those games rather than the ones he sat out injured.
